    World Cup 2026 Round of 16 Argentina vs. Egypt Predictions

    Argentina face Egypt in the World Cup 2026 Round of 16 at Mercedes-Benz Stadium in Atlanta on July 7, with kickoff at 12:00 PM ET. The defending champions enter as heavy favorites at -250, while Egypt arrive having already made history by reaching the knockout stage for the first time since 1934.

    The match odds reflect the gulf in class that most observers expect to define this contest. Argentina are priced at -250 with BetOnline, while Egypt are out at +750 with the same operator. The draw sits at +370. With Lionel Messi (39) having scored seven goals at this tournament already, and Egypt’s Mohamed Salah (34) carrying the weight of a nation’s expectations, this World Cup 2026 knockout stage fixture carries genuine star power on both sides.

    Why This Game Matters

    Argentina are chasing back-to-back World Cup titles, a feat achieved only by Italy (1934, 1938) and Brazil (1958, 1962). Egypt, meanwhile, are competing in their first knockout match since 1934 and have a chance to reach a first-ever quarter-final, making this already the greatest World Cup campaign in the Pharaohs’ modern history. The World Cup 2026 bracket opens up considerably for the winner, and Argentina’s path toward a second consecutive championship runs directly through Atlanta.

    Argentina vs Egypt: Preview, Picks & Betting Odds

    Argentina enter this Round of 16 fixture as the tournament’s second-ranked outright contenders at +425, having navigated a demanding group that included wins over Austria (2-0) and Jordan (3-1), as well as a 1-1 draw with Cape Verde. Lionel Scaloni’s side have scored ten goals in their last four competitive fixtures at this World Cup, with Messi responsible for seven of them. The 39-year-old’s form at this tournament is the central factor shaping Argentina’s World Cup 2026 round of 16 Argentina vs. Egypt odds across every major sportsbook.

    Egypt qualified from a group containing Belgium and Australia, drawing 1-1 with both before defeating New Zealand 3-1. Hossam Hassan’s side have shown they are not merely making up the numbers, but their squad composition tells a different story to Argentina’s when it comes to depth and individual quality. Eight players in their squad are based at Egyptian club Al Ahly, and while Mohamed Salah and Omar Marmoush (27) provide genuine Premier League and top-flight pedigree, the Pharaohs’ supporting cast will be tested severely at this level.

    The central narrative of this World Cup 2026 round of 16 Argentina vs. Egypt fixture is whether Egypt’s disciplined, compact structure can limit Argentina’s attacking output. Egypt drew 1-1 with Belgium, a result that demonstrates their ability to absorb pressure, but Argentina’s movement and the creativity of Alexis Mac Allister (27) and Enzo Fernandez (25) in central midfield present a different order of challenge. Argentina’s -250 moneyline price reflects both quality and expectation.

    Recent Form & Trends

    Argentina’s last five matches:

    • Cape Verde (H): Drew 1-1 – FIFA World Cup
    • Jordan (A): Won 3-1 – FIFA World Cup
    • Austria (H): Won 2-0 – FIFA World Cup
    • Algeria (H): Won 3-0 – FIFA World Cup
    • Iceland (N): Won 3-0 – Friendly

    Argentina’s group-stage results include a stumble against Cape Verde but three wins across their four other recent competitive fixtures, all with multiple goals scored. The Algeria and Austria victories were clean sheets, underlining that Scaloni’s side can shut opponents out as well as pile on goals. The Cape Verde draw is the lone blemish in an otherwise commanding recent run.

    Egypt’s last five matches:

    • Australia (A): Drew 1-1 – FIFA World Cup
    • Iran (H): Drew 1-1 – FIFA World Cup
    • New Zealand (A): Won 3-1 – FIFA World Cup
    • Belgium (A): Drew 1-1 – FIFA World Cup
    • Brazil (N): Lost 1-2 – Friendly

    Egypt’s group-stage form is defined by draws. Three 1-1 results from four competitive outings underline a team built around resilience rather than attacking ambition, with only the 3-1 win over New Zealand standing as evidence of genuine firepower. Emam Ashour (28) leads their tournament scoring with two goals, while Salah and four others have contributed one apiece. The pattern of single-goal draws will be tested severely against an Argentina attack averaging more than two goals per competitive game at this tournament.

    Injuries, Suspensions & Roster News

    Argentina carry one of the deepest squads in the tournament into Atlanta. Messi’s fitness entering the knockout rounds is the most closely watched question in world football, with the Inter Miami CF forward having played a full group stage. Lisandro Martinez (28, Manchester United) is available in central defense, having contributed a goal in the group stage, and Scaloni has options across every position. The midfield combination of Mac Allister, Fernandez, and Rodrigo De Paul (32) gives Argentina control in the center of the park.

    Egypt’s squad lacks the depth of the top seeds but Hossam Hassan has a full complement of players available heading into this fixture. Salah’s partnership with Marmoush (Manchester City) in attack is the cornerstone of Egypt’s offensive threat. Goalkeeper Mohamed El Shenawy (37) brings significant experience with 76 caps, and the defense, anchored by a majority of Al Ahly-based players, has at least shown familiarity with each other’s movement across the group stage.

    Neither side has reported significant injuries or suspensions ahead of this World Cup 2026 round of 16 fixture. Both squads are announced and appear to be at full strength for the knockout opener.

    Key Matchup to Watch

    The duel between Messi and Egypt’s defensive block shapes this game entirely. Messi has scored seven goals at this tournament, a figure that makes him the clear standout scorer in Atlanta regardless of context. Egypt’s defensive unit, built largely around Al Ahly-based players who compete in the Egyptian Premier League, has shipped goals in three of their four competitive group matches. The question is not whether Messi will find space, but how early and how often. Mac Allister and Fernandez will look to pull Egypt’s midfield into wide areas, creating the central lanes that Messi and Lautaro Martinez (28) exploit most effectively. Egypt’s best hope is absorbing early pressure and finding Salah in transition.
